What is Number Sense?

According to research published on ScienceDirect, number sense is defined as a "cognitive understanding of numbers and their relationships" (Author et al., Year). This broad definition includes several key components:

  1. Number Recognition: The ability to identify and name numbers accurately.
  2. Magnitude Understanding: Grasping the size of numbers, knowing which are larger or smaller, and understanding their relative values.
  3. Flexibility with Numbers: The capacity to manipulate numbers through mental math, estimation, and other strategies.
  4. Understanding of Numerical Relationships: Recognizing how numbers relate to one another, such as through addition, subtraction, multiplication, or division.

Cultivating Number Sense

1. Use of Visual Aids

Visual aids, such as number lines, graphs, and manipulatives, can help students visualize mathematical concepts. For example, using a number line allows students to see the relative distance between numbers, which enhances their understanding of magnitude.

2. Real-World Applications

Incorporating real-world examples into math lessons can make the subject matter more relevant. For instance, discussing grocery prices or budgeting can help students apply their number sense in practical situations. This approach can make learning more engaging and impactful.

3. Encourage Mental Math

Promoting mental math can strengthen students' number sense. Activities such as estimating the total cost of items while shopping or calculating the time needed to travel a certain distance can sharpen their numerical abilities and boost their confidence.
